    Google give a New Content Boost to new pages and new sites, this boost helps them rank high in search results. But this boost is only temporary.

    I guess your site is new right? And that is why traffic is lowered and I am afraid that traffic will reach zero if you do not build backlinks for your site and update content.

    Check your statistics and see which keywords you don't rank for anymore.
    Than focus on those keywords and try to get more backlinks with anchor text that particular keyword.
    We are talking about very insignificant traffic here so fluctuations might be due to google dance.

    You are obviously still indexed since you are still getting search engine traffic, but you have probably dropped in the SERPs

    The most frequently quoted cause of this is bad backlinks
    Bad meaning either from bad neighbourhoods or bought links
